North West, the 12-year-old daughter of Kim Kardashian and Kanye West, is already proving she has inherited both the spotlight and the style that run deep in her famous family.
On Thursday evening, she made her highly anticipated debut at the Venice Film Festival in Italy, walking hand in hand with her mother, Kim Kardashian, and immediately becoming one of the most talked-about guests of the night.
Dressed in a bold, fashion-forward look that blended youthful charm with couture edge, North captivated photographers and onlookers as she posed confidently for the cameras.
The mother-daughter duo arrived at the iconic Palazzo del Cinema venue just before the screening of one of the festival’s most anticipated films.
Kim, 43, wore a sleek black gown with daring cutouts, accentuated by dazzling jewelry and her signature flawless makeup.
But it was North who stole the show.
The young fashionista wore a structured ensemble featuring a vibrant pop of color and accessories that highlighted her playful yet mature sense of style.
Witnesses described her as “radiant, confident, and clearly aware that she was stepping into her own spotlight.”
This red-carpet moment comes at a particularly controversial time for the Kardashian family.
Just days earlier, Kim was criticized online after North was spotted in Los Angeles wearing a corset-style top during a dinner outing.
Social media exploded with debates over whether it was appropriate for a 12-year-old to wear such a piece.
Critics accused Kim of pushing her daughter into adulthood too soon, while others defended the family, arguing that fashion has always been central to their brand and that North should be allowed to experiment with her own style.
When asked about the controversy by a reporter outside the venue, Kim reportedly smiled and brushed off the criticism, saying, “North knows who she is, and she loves expressing herself through clothes.
That’s her choice, and I support her.”
Industry insiders say North’s Venice appearance was not just a casual outing but a carefully planned introduction to the international fashion scene.
According to a stylist close to the Kardashian family, the outfit was custom-designed for North by an up-and-coming Milanese designer who has also worked with high-profile celebrities.
“This was meant to be her statement moment,” the stylist revealed.
“Kim wanted to show the world that North isn’t just a kid in the background — she’s already carving out her own identity in fashion.”
Indeed, North West has been no stranger to the spotlight.
Over the past few years, she has made headlines for sitting front row at Paris Fashion Week alongside her mom, wearing designer looks from Balenciaga and Dolce & Gabbana.
In one memorable moment in 2022, North held up a handwritten sign at a show reading “STOP” to signal her frustration with paparazzi constantly taking pictures, a candid display of her growing awareness of fame and media attention.
